How to Make 4th of July Rice Krispie Treats

Step 1: Prepare Your Dish

Grease a 9×13 dish and set it aside to prevent sticking later.

Step 2: Make the Red Layer

  1. In a large saucepan, melt 3oz of butter over low heat.
  2. Add in 10oz of marshmallows, stirring until smooth.
  3. Mix in red food coloring until you reach your desired shade.

Step 3: Combine Cereal with Red Mixture

  1. Stir in puffed rice cereal until fully coated.
  2. Transfer this mixture into the prepared pan, pressing down firmly to flatten.

Step 4: Make the White Layer

  1. Repeat steps from above using another 3oz of butter and the remaining marshmallows without adding any food coloring.
  2. Press this white mixture onto the red layer in the pan.

Step 5: Make the Blue Layer

  1. Melt another 3oz of butter in a saucepan.
  2. Add in another batch of marshmallows and stir until smooth.
  3. Mix in blue food coloring to achieve your preferred color.

Step 6: Combine Cereal with Blue Mixture

  1. Stir in puffed rice cereal until fully coated again.
  2. Spread this blue mixture on top of the white layer, pressing down gently but firmly.

Step 7: Cut and Serve

Allow the treats to firm up at room temperature before cutting them into squares (5×4). Enjoy your deliciously festive creation!

Ingredients

Scale
  • 30 oz marshmallows (divided)
  • 18 cups puffed rice cereal (divided)
  • 9 oz unsalted butter (divided)
  • Red food coloring
  • Blue food coloring

Instructions

  1. Grease a 9×13 inch baking dish.
  2. Melt 3 oz butter in a saucepan; add 10 oz marshmallows and red food coloring until smooth.
  3. Mix in 6 cups puffed rice cereal; press into the prepared dish.
  4. Repeat with white layer (3 oz butter + 10 oz marshmallows) over red layer.
  5. For blue layer, melt another 3 oz butter; mix in 10 oz marshmallows and blue food coloring.
  6. Combine with remaining puffed rice cereal; spread over the white layer.
  7. Allow to cool before cutting into squares.
